Who dies?
Yes, one character dies in the TV show Boots (2025): Eduardo Ochoa.
Ochoa's death occurs in Episode 5 ("Bullseye") and is fully revealed in Episode 6. He is a devoted Marine and a skilled marksman who struggles with conflicting feelings about killing and personal issues. Ochoa experiences chest pains but ignores them, not seeking medical help. After earning a phone call home due to his sharpshooting skills, he learns that his wife Gloria is cheating on him, which devastates him emotionally. This heartbreak, combined with intense physical and emotional stress during brutal training drills led by his drill sergeant Howitt, pushes Ochoa to a breaking point. He collapses during training, and despite attempts at CPR, he dies from an undiagnosed heart condition he had hidden from the Corps. His death marks a sobering tonal shift in the series.
No other character deaths are explicitly mentioned in the available information about the show.
